MARC::XMLMARC::XML is a subclass of MARC.pm to provide XML support. | |
Download |
MARC::XML Ranking & Summary
Advertisement
- License:
- Perl Artistic License
- Price:
- FREE
- Publisher Name:
- MARC::XML team
- Publisher web site:
- http://search.cpan.org/~bbirth/MARC-XML-0.4/XML.pm
MARC::XML Tags
MARC::XML Description
MARC::XML is a subclass of MARC.pm to provide XML support. MARC::XML is a subclass of MARC.pm to provide XML support.SYNOPSIS use MARC::XML; #read in some MARC and output some XML $myobject = MARC::XML->new("marc.mrc","usmarc"); $myobject->output({file=>">marc.xml",format=>"xml"}); #read in some XML and output some MARC $myobject = MARC::XML->new("marc.xml","xml"); $myobject->output({file=>">marc.mrc","usmarc");MARC::XML is a subclass of MARC.pm which provides methods for round-trip conversions between MARC and XML. MARC::XML requires that you have the CPAN modules MARC.pm and XML::Parser installed in your Perl library. Version 1.04 of MARC.pm and 2.27 of XML::Parser (or later) are required. As a subclass of MARC.pm a MARC::XML object will by default have the full functionality of a MARC.pm object. See the MARC.pm documentation for details.The XML file that is read and generated by MARC::XML is not associated with a Document Type Definition (DTD). This means that your files need to be well-formed, but they will not be validated. When performing XML->MARC conversion it is important that the XML file is structured in a particular way. Fortunately, this is the same format that is generated by the MARC->XML conversion, so you should be able to be able to move your data easily between the two formats. Requirements: · Perl
MARC::XML Related Software